次のデータがあります。
単語 2013 年 1 月 2013 年 2 月 2013 年 3 月 1 2 3 B 5 2 4
複数の日付列を日付という名前の 1 つに変換し、値の列を追加したいと考えています。
単語の日付値 A 2013 年 1 月 1 2013年2月 2 2013年3月 3 B 2013 年 1 月 5 B 2013 年 2 月 2 B 2013年3月 4
誰でも手伝ってもらえますか?
ありがとう
Metricsの回答に加えて、Rの2つの追加オプションがあります(あなたdata.frame
が「mydf」と呼ばれると仮定します):
cbind(mydf[1], stack(mydf[-1]))
library(reshape)
melt(mydf, id.vars="word")
私は Excel ユーザーではありませんが、この質問にも「Excel」というタグが付けられているため、Tableau Reshaper Excel アドオンをお勧めします。
あなたの例では、それは非常に簡単です:
アドオンをインストールしてアクティブ化したら、[Tableau] メニューに移動します。
スタックを解除する値を含むセルを選択します。[OK] をクリックします。
結果を表示します。